> >> OVN 26.03 introduced distributed load balancers [1]: when a
> >> Load_Balancer has options:distributed=true and ip_port_mappings is
> >> configured, each chassis delivers traffic only to the local backend.
> >> Deployments that use BGP to advertise tenant routes into the fabric
> >> [2] could previously advertise LB VIPs only as a single prefix per
> >> VIP, with no per-chassis health awareness. The fabric could ECMP
> >> across chassis but could not prefer those hosting healthy backends
> >> or withdraw routes from chassis with unhealthy ones.
> >>
> >> This series splits the Advertised_Route emission for LB VIPs from
> >> one-per-VIP to one-per-(VIP, backend LSP) and adds a controller-side
> >> gate that skips route installation when the Service_Monitor for the
> >> corresponding backend is offline. This allows the local dynamic
> >> routing speaker to advertise the VIP prefix only from chassis that
> >> host a healthy backend, so fabric ECMP converges onto
> >> healthy chassis.
> >>
> >> The series also installs local forwarding routes on the advertising
> >> logical router for peer-LR LB VIPs and NAT external IPs enumerated for
> >> redistribution, so that the advertising LR can forward traffic to
> >> those addresses through the peer.

> >> Patch 1 fixes an existing bug where attaching a distributed LB to a
> >> router with a chassis-redirect port can leave stale lr_in_admission
> >> guards, dropping ingress LB traffic on non-gateway chassis.
> >>
> >> Patch 2 fixes a pre-existing bug in parsed_route_lookup() where the
> >> IPv6 nexthop comparison skipped matching routes instead of
> >> non-matching ones, causing false lookups for IPv6 routes with
> >> non-zero nexthops. The forwarding-route tests in patch 3 exercise
> >> this code path: the nexthop mutation test checks that a route whose
> >> nexthop changes is not treated as unchanged.
> >>
> >> Patch 3 installs local forwarding routes for peer-LR LB VIPs and NAT
> >> external IPs that an advertising LRP has enumerated for redistribution.
> >>
> >> Patch 4 splits Advertised_Route emission from one-per-VIP to
> >> one-per-(VIP, backend LSP), populating service selector columns
> >> that let ovn-controller match the Service_Monitor row for each
> >> backend.
> >>
> >> Patch 5 adds the controller-side gate: kernel-route installation is
> >> skipped when the Service_Monitor for a backend is offline.

> >> A separate LRP option for VRF route sharing (share-advertise-routes)
> >> is deferred to a follow-up series. Deployments that need cross-VRF
> >> route sharing before the option lands can achieve the same effect
> >> by configuring the dynamic routing speaker to import routes between
> >> the OVN-managed VRFs on each chassis.
> >>
> >> Prior work: RFC for LB BGP advertisement [3] in which a review [4]
> >> suggested a separate incremental processing node for dynamic routes,
> >> which this series adopts. For tracked_port, patch 3 uses the peer LRP
> >> for forwarding routes and patch 4 uses the backend LSP (from
> >> ip_port_mappings) for per-backend locality rows. Patch 5 adds
> >> Service_Monitor gating on the per-backend rows.
> >>
> >> The SB schema (version 21.9.0) gains tracked_service_{ip,port,protocol}
> >> columns on Advertised_Route for the service selector. All new columns
> >> are optional with safe defaults, so rolling upgrades are supported.
> >> Builds on the distributed LB feature (OVN 26.03+).
> >>
> >> Tests cover LB and NAT route redistribution (IPv4/IPv6), forwarding
> >> route installation, per-backend selector emission, SCTP exclusion,
> >> ip_port_mappings fallback (per-backend rows when mappings exist,
> >> one peer-LRP row when none do), and Service_Monitor gating.
